Commit 01bdec12 authored by Le Roux Erwan's avatar Le Roux Erwan
Browse files

[contrasting] add slight modification for the second round of review for NHESS

parent dcb45778
No related merge requests found
Showing with 17 additions and 11 deletions
+17 -11
...@@ -16,7 +16,7 @@ def max_graph_annual_maxima_comparison(): ...@@ -16,7 +16,7 @@ def max_graph_annual_maxima_comparison():
we also choose them because they belong to a different climatic area we also choose them because they belong to a different climatic area
:return: :return:
""" """
save_to_file = False save_to_file = True
study_classes = [ study_classes = [
CrocusSnowDensityAtMaxofSwe, CrocusSnowDensityAtMaxofSwe,
CrocusDifferenceSnowLoad, CrocusDifferenceSnowLoad,
...@@ -30,10 +30,16 @@ def max_graph_annual_maxima_comparison(): ...@@ -30,10 +30,16 @@ def max_graph_annual_maxima_comparison():
for study_class in study_classes: for study_class in study_classes:
ylim, yticks = study_class_to_ylim_and_yticks[study_class] ylim, yticks = study_class_to_ylim_and_yticks[study_class]
# marker_altitude_massif_name = [
# ('magenta', 900, 'Ubaye'),
# ('darkmagenta', 1800, 'Vercors'),
# ('mediumpurple', 2700, 'Beaufortain'),
# ][:]
marker_altitude = [ marker_altitude = [
('deepskyblue', 900), ('magenta', 900),
('dodgerblue', 1800), ('darkmagenta', 1800),
('blue', 2700), ('mediumpurple', 2700),
][:] ][:]
ax = plt.gca() ax = plt.gca()
for color, altitude in marker_altitude: for color, altitude in marker_altitude:
......
...@@ -73,9 +73,9 @@ def intermediate_result(altitudes, massif_names=None, ...@@ -73,9 +73,9 @@ def intermediate_result(altitudes, massif_names=None,
# Plots # Plots
# plot_trend_map(altitude_to_visualizer) # plot_trend_map(altitude_to_visualizer)
# plot_trend_curves(altitude_to_visualizer={a: v for a, v in altitude_to_visualizer.items() if a >= 900}) plot_trend_curves(altitude_to_visualizer={a: v for a, v in altitude_to_visualizer.items() if a >= 900})
# plot_uncertainty_massifs(altitude_to_visualizer) # plot_uncertainty_massifs(altitude_to_visualizer)
plot_uncertainty_histogram(altitude_to_visualizer) # plot_uncertainty_histogram(altitude_to_visualizer)
# plot_selection_curves(altitude_to_visualizer) # plot_selection_curves(altitude_to_visualizer)
# plot_intensity_against_gumbel_quantile_for_3_examples(altitude_to_visualizer) # plot_intensity_against_gumbel_quantile_for_3_examples(altitude_to_visualizer)
...@@ -89,11 +89,11 @@ def major_result(): ...@@ -89,11 +89,11 @@ def major_result():
ConfidenceIntervalMethodFromExtremes.ci_mle][1:] ConfidenceIntervalMethodFromExtremes.ci_mle][1:]
# massif_names = ['Beaufortain', 'Vercors'] # massif_names = ['Beaufortain', 'Vercors']
massif_names = None massif_names = None
study_classes = paper_study_classes[:] study_classes = paper_study_classes[:1]
# study_classes = [CrocusSnowLoad3Days, CrocusSnowLoad5Days, CrocusSnowLoad7Days][::-1] # study_classes = [CrocusSnowLoad3Days, CrocusSnowLoad5Days, CrocusSnowLoad7Days][::-1]
altitudes = [300, 600, 900, 1800, 2700][:2] altitudes = [300, 600, 900, 1800, 2700][:]
altitudes = [300, 600, 900, 1200, 1500, 1800] altitudes = [300, 600, 900, 1200, 1500, 1800][2:]
# altitudes = paper_altitudes altitudes = paper_altitudes
# altitudes = [900, 1800, 270{{0][:1] # altitudes = [900, 1800, 270{{0][:1]
for study_class in study_classes: for study_class in study_classes:
print('new stuy class', study_class) print('new stuy class', study_class)
......
...@@ -47,7 +47,7 @@ def plot_trend_curves(altitude_to_visualizer: Dict[int, StudyVisualizerForNonSta ...@@ -47,7 +47,7 @@ def plot_trend_curves(altitude_to_visualizer: Dict[int, StudyVisualizerForNonSta
# parameters # parameters
width = 150 width = 150
size = 20 size = 20
legend_fontsize = 20 legend_fontsize = 35
color = 'white' color = 'white'
labelsize = 15 labelsize = 15
linewidth = 3 linewidth = 3
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ment